Judging by the pics and your info seems like a decent truck. It has towed some as there is a trailer brake controller and having the owner paont the whole under side could mean a few problems not seen by the naked eye. Have to go over it with and look for anything wrong with it closely. The 7.3 are strong running rigs and when maintanced run forever. The trans is a weak link in all of the 7.3 once you make power, they are like the dodge transmissions. So with the billet parts you say it has in it I am sure it can handle some abuse here and there. Also for the turbo see what air filter he is running, a K&N or anything similir they turbo will be pitted and loose at the shaft. Bad news as a lot of guys with turbo applications have that same thing happen to them. Get rid of it asap. Check for leaks all over the truck. Drive it for a good 30-45 mins so everything gets well lubed and up to operate temps them go over it again. I would say the truck should go for $15-17k, remember it is all worth as much as someone is willing to pay for it. Some good news is it a 1999-2000? If it is the rods and such are forged so it will handle 500rwhp with ease. If it is a 2001-2003 odds are it doe snot have forged rods and they weak link in the motor. Go with a DP tuner, the best in the buiz for the 7.3 hands down! It has gauges on it which is a good thing. Just have a list of all what is done on it and will help greatly!

Danhoe is the king of lifts for the Superduties and the rest looks good besides that damn filter! I would drive it for an hour or so and let it get all warmed up. I wanna say the FCIM sensor goes bad roughly $15 bucks, it is a crank sensor that randomly goes bad for some reason. Make sure it starts easy and no crank, wait crank BS! JUst look the truck over good and ask as many quesitions as you can. AS no quesition is a dumb quesition. If you are happy with it sign and drive away, just dont pay over $17K as for a few bucks more get a 6.0 and will blow the 7.3 doors off.
